Course programme
AS/A2 Spanish
Who is this course for?
Anyone who wishes to study Spanish at a higher level.
What will I learn?
You will develop your ability to speak, write, read and listen to the language. This will include comprehension, translation and discussion skills in a number of contemporary topics which will look at the country's lifestyle and culture.
Assessment
AS Level: this qualification is divided into two modules, which are taken separately. There is a speaking module and a listening/reading/writing module. There will be a small piece of writing (200 - 250 words). A2 Level: there are again two modules, one for speaking and one which covers listening/reading/writing. The writing task will cover an element of culture, for example cinema, literature or the study of a specific Spanish-speaking region.
On Completion Achievement / Progression
A modern foreign language is useful in a number of degree courses such as law, journalism, media, education, marketing and tourism. Alternatively, this course will enhance your prospects in seeking employment where they may be Spanish or Latin-American business links within an organisation or careers in areas such as diplomacy, art or tourism.

Requirement
You will need the minimum entry requirement of 4 Grade Cs or above at GCSE level, one in Spanish unless you have worked or lived in a Spanish-speaking country and acquired the use of the language in this way. You will need to have achieved the AS qualification before progressing on to the A2 level course. Students wishing to take this subject as part of the full-time provision should complete an application form on receipt of which we will invite you to the college for an informal interview where you will have the opportunity to talk with the tutors.
